FAQ



How many images do you deliver from an engagement session? From a wedding?

For a 1-hour engagement session, we typically deliver 30-60 professionally edited images. For a wedding day, you can expect 40-70 images per hour of coverage. The final number may vary depending on the events and activities throughout the day, ensuring every meaningful moment is beautifully captured.


When can we expect to see our photos?

Post-production for weddings and engagement sessions typically takes 4-8 weeks from the shoot date. However, turnaround times may be faster depending on the schedule and workload.


What happens if we go over the contracted amount of time?

Weddings are never the same and not everything goes as planned. We will not pack up before the contracted time and we will visit with your regarding the remainder of your event. If you would like us to stay, we will charge the rates specified in your contract rounded to the closest 30-minute increment.
